    Jumper wire connected to terminal box

    Terminal block jumpers are used to electrically interconnect terminal blocks. Jumpers are available in various styles and dimensions, in a range of pole configurations. The push-in style installs into the wire openings; the screw-down style mounts across the tops of consecutive. DIN rail mounted terminal blocks are found in nearly every industrial control panel. This provides a convenient way to expand the number of wires attached to a single node. This is particularly useful. [0m:17s] Also, sometimes referred to as a jumper bar or terminal block jumper, a jumper is typically a short length of conductor, commonly copper, that is used to connect two or more points within an electrical circuit.     Color order of fiber optic terminal box wires

    Fibers 13-16 are specified for 16 fiber MPO connectors as follows: 13: Olive, 14: Magenta, 15: Tan, 16: Lime. Note: This 16-color sequence is often used in specific European standards (DIN) or high-density ribbon cables. Explosion-proof terminals and junction boxes are critical components for industries such as petrochemical, chemical, oil and gas, and other sectors where hazardous environments involving explosive gases or combustible dust are present. To ensure safe operation in these zones, such equipment must. Safely conduct, connect and distribute energy in hazardous areas with R. Types of explosion protection include Ex db, Ex eb with IP66 degree of protection.

    Can the terminal box be placed in the basement

    It is generally possible to install a junction box in the basement, provided you adhere to local building codes, consider accessibility, moisture, and ventilation, and prioritize safety. However, there are a few factors to consider before proceeding: 1. Here are the main things you must do: Only use metal or certain plastics that do not burn. I. According to the NEC (National Electrical Code), all wire splices and electrical connections must be enclosed within an approved electrical junction box to ensure safety, accessibility, and code compliance. A junction box protects wire connections from physical damage, reduces shock and fire risks.
